TEFLON:
- Most
commonly used seat material for food application. Has
extensive chemical and temperature resistance.
- Not
suitable for great temperature fluctuations: Teflon tends
to coldflow and does not return to its original shape.
- Can
be used as a coating on other elastomers.
- Useful
temperature range: -30°F to 400°F
BUNA
N:
- Nitrile
compound provides an elastic seat that makes for leak-free,
easy handling of valve. Least expensive elastomer.
- Good
chemical resistance: excellent for use with petroleum
solvents, gasoline, alcohol, etc...
- Recommended
lubricant:
silicone
- Useful
temperature range: -40°F to 225°F
SILICONE:
- Very
good seat material, very elastic self-lubricating - provides
a tight easy seal, reducing torque needed to close the
valves.
- Sensitive
to certain chemicals: do not use with solvents,
petroleum products, etc. (check with us for non-food usage)
- Useful
temperature range: -85°F to 450°F
EPDM:
- Good
for steam and hot water to 350°F
- Good
resistance to mild acids, dilute alkalis, silicone oils
and greases, ketones and alcohol.
- Avoid
use for petroleum oils or di-ester base lubricants.
- Useful
temperature range: -65°F to 300°F
VITON®:
- Both
extreme temperature and good chemical resistance.
- Useful
at high temperature when buna or EPDM is not suitable.
- Recommended
lubricant: silicone
- Useful
temperature range: -31°F to 400°F
